AWARD Voices from Milan – Interviews from the 3rd General Assembly

 

 

During AWARD’s 3rd General Assembly in Milan, three short interviews were conducted to highlight different perspectives on the project and its demonstration activities.

Through the voices of Anna Varisco, Mayor of Paderno Dugnano, Francesca Framba from the Metropolitan City of Milan, and Stefan Görlitz from InterSus, these videos offer insights into local engagement, sustainable water management, governance, and the role of Alternative Water Resources in building more resilient territories.

Natacha Amorsi - Project Coordination WP1

AWARD is a three-year project, funded by the European Commission’s Horizon Europe. Natacha AMORSI, the AWARD coordinator, describes its goal : to enhance water management by integrating Alternative Water Resources (AWR) into strategic planning.

The ambition is to provide evidence-based knowledge and lessons learned on the effective integration of affordable, acceptable, and reliable AWR solutions tested and monitored in 4 Demo Cases. Consortium: The project is coordinated by OiEau and brings together 14 beneficiaries and 2 affiliated entities across 7 European countries.
